Those marks can easily be removed using a common ingredient that you probably have in your refrigerator – ordinary mayonnaise! As soon as you see a water mark, gently blot the surface dry. Then apply a layer of mayonnaise with a spatula or paper towel. Leave it overnight, then wipe and buff with a clean cloth.

Moreover, how do you remove old water stains?
Combine Vinegar and Olive Oil
In a small bowl, mix equal parts vinegar and olive oil. Apply the mixture to the water stain using a cloth. Wipe in the direction of the wood grain until the stain is gone. The vinegar will help remove the stain while the olive oil acts as a furniture polish.

Does toothpaste remove water stains wood?
Toothpaste. … To get rid of those telltale watermark rings left by sweating beverages, gently rub some non-gel toothpaste with a soft cloth on the surface to remove water stains from wood. Then wipe it off with a damp cloth and let it dry before applying furniture polish.

How do I get white haze off my wood table?
Soak a clean, soft rag in mineral spirits. Wipe the cloudy area with the cloth, using long strokes that match the grain of the wood. The wax finish should start to look hazy and dull as it is being removed. Work in small sections if there is a large area of cloudiness to be removed.
How do you get water stains out of lacquered wood?
How to Remove Watermarks
- One method of removing white water marks (rings) is to wipe over with a lightly alcohol-dampened cloth. …
- For lacquer finishes, spraying a light mist of “blush” eliminator (butyl Cellosolve) is very effective for removing light water damage.
How does bleach remove water stains from wood?
Remove Dark Water Stains With a Bleach Solution
- Create a solution of 50-percent cool water and 50-percent bleach.
- Lightly apply the solution to the wood stains with a dense sponge. Do not drench the wood.
- Allow the bleached wood to fully dry. …
- Assess the results.
